Fred Luthans is a management professor specializing in organizational behavior. He is the university and George Holmes Distinguished Professor of Management, emeritus at the University of Nebraska–Lincoln.

Fred Luthans is a renowned American academic born in Clinton in 1939.
His distinguished career as a university professor has shaped the study of organizational behavior.
He is the author of the influential work Organizational behavior, a benchmark in the business field.
Throughout his career, he has published a total of 60 works specializing in management and economics.
His research covers key topics such as international business and business case studies.
